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Urmston to Canterbury West start from as little as £49.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Urmston to Canterbury West start from £99.10 one way, or £141.70 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Urmston to Canterbury West are available for £232.40 one way, or £464.80 return

Station Facilities and Accessibility

Urmston Train Station offers a range of facilities for travelers, ensuring comfort and convenience. The ticket office is operational Monday to Saturday, offering services during morning hours. For those who prefer self-service, machines are available, though not all are accessible. While smartcards can be issued here, validation happens elsewhere. Security is a priority, with CCTV installed around the station.

Travelers with mobility challenges will find the station categorized as a "Category B" facility. This means that parts of the station offer step-free access, while others may require assistance. Ramps are available, ensuring that even with limited facilities, the station maintains accessibility. Detailed information about the station layout can be explored through a 360 map tour online.

However, amenities such as public Wi-Fi, refreshment facilities, and waiting rooms are absent, so travelers might want to prepare for their journey beforehand.

Transport Links and Onward Travel

Urmston offers multiple transport links, enhancing connectivity to local attractions and beyond. For instance, buses to Manchester and Trafford Park depart from nearby Flixton Road. Whether you're catching a rail replacement service or need a taxi, Urmston makes it easy to continue your journey. Check out their cab service options to ensure a hassle-free experience.

While there’s no direct bicycle hire at the station, cycling enthusiasts can still make use of six available bike hoops for short-term storage.

Ticketing and Travel Essentials

Canterbury West is equipped with a comprehensive ticket system including a staffed ticket office open from 06:15 to 19:30 on weekdays and Saturdays, while operating reduced hours on Sundays. For your convenience, ticket machines are available for both purchase and collection, and these include accessible options ensuring everyone can get their journey underway with ease. Additionally, smartcard options and validations are provided at the station.

If you require help navigating the station, assistance is available from 05:00 until late into the night, with staff ready to aid you in accessing platforms and boarding trains. For those who need it, step-free access is provided to all platforms, along with the availability of ramps and accessible toilets.

Expect Exceptional Customer Service

Your experience at Canterbury West is enhanced by customer support services that include information points, departure screens, and station announcements to keep you informed. Although there's no waiting room office, seating areas are available for your comfort. Secure station accreditation highlights the station's dedication to customer safety, underpinned by a CCTV system throughout.

Travel and Transit Options

Transport connections extend beyond rail, with a taxi rank conveniently situated at the station entrance. Rail replacement services are coordinated at the station forecourt, and bicycle hire is readily accessible via Brompton Dock. The station also offers a downloadable onward travel map for planning further journeys.

Facilities Summary and Conclusion

Refreshment facilities, including a coffee shop and vending machines, cater to your cravings, though unfortunately, there are no ATMs or shops available on-site. Parking is managed by APCOA, offering 112 spaces with an off-peak evening rate starting at £1.50.
